From CBS Sports.com
Francis was listed on 12/3/08 as out indefinitely due to a knee injury.
http://www.cbssports.com/nba/players/playerpage/139064
He has been bought out and waived, 1/27/09.
From ESPN 1/27/09
http://sports.espn.go.com/nba/news/story?id=3864959
Francis, a 6-foot-3, 210-pound guard, did not appear in a game for Memphis or travel with the Grizzlies, though he did occasionally practice with the team.
